Preceptor Elizabeth Jiei Cole

Betty Jiei Cole began her Zen practice with Robert Aitken Roshi in 1979, drawn to his strong integration of Zen practice and realization with writing and actions in ecology, peace and restorative justice. She came to him from Quaker work with the American Friends Service Committee and a sense of spiritual crisis in the midst of struggles in the peace movement. Her spiritual path continues to be enriched by her involvement with the Zen Center of Los Angeles, continuing dialogue and action especially in racial awareness, human rights and deep ecology, and life at All Saints Episcopal Church. She has led the Monday Night Meditation group there as a ZCLA satellite group for the last 24 years.
